Semantic and Heuristic Based Approach for Paraphrase Identification
2018
2018 14th International Conference on Semantics, Knowledge and Grids (SKG)
In this paper, we propose a semantic-based paraphrase identification approach. The core concept of this proposal is to identify paraphrases when sentences contain a set of namedentities and common words. The developed approach distinguishes the computation of the semantic similarity of namedentity tokens from the rest of the sentence text.
